BeautifulSoup支持大部分的CSS選擇器,其語法為:向tag或soup對象的.select()方法中傳入字符串參數,選擇的結果以列表形式返回。 tag.select("string") BeautifulSoup.select("string") 源代碼示例 ...
BeautifulSoup .安裝和文檔 .主要的解析器 .簡單使用 .常用方法示例find all ... .區分小知識點 CSS選擇器 通過標簽名查找 通過類名查找 通過 id 名查找 組合查找 屬性查找 獲取內容 select和css選擇器提取元素示例 練習:中國天氣網爬蟲之所有城市數據爬取 BeautifulSoup 和 lxml 一樣,Beautiful Soup 也是一個HTML XM ...
2018-12-27 00:45 0 758 推薦指數:
BeautifulSoup支持大部分的CSS選擇器,其語法為:向tag或soup對象的.select()方法中傳入字符串參數,選擇的結果以列表形式返回。 tag.select("string") BeautifulSoup.select("string") 源代碼示例 ...
注意事項 1、測試工具pycharm,請自行安裝, 2、python3.x 3、需要導入requests庫和bs4庫 4、項目目錄結構 run.py rentspider.py 測試開始~~~~~~~~~ 標簽選擇器 示例代碼 ...
BeautifulSoup是一個靈活有方便的網頁解系庫,處理搞笑,支持多種解析器,利用他可以不編寫正賊表達式即可方便實現網頁信息的提取。 解析庫: 我們主要用lxml解析器 標簽選擇器: 這里我們print了soup.title、head、p ...
喜歡我的博客可以加關注,有問題可以提問我。 1.基本使用(下面的html由於過長就不復制了都復用第一個) 2.選擇元素 3.獲取名稱 4.獲取屬性 5.獲取內容 6.嵌套選擇 ...
總結來源於官方文檔:https://www.crummy.com/software/BeautifulSoup/bs4/doc/index.zh.html#find-all 示例代碼段 ...
1.>(子選擇器) #a>p{ // 使用 > 號,讓選擇器選擇id="a"的所有子類(直接子類) 結果: 2.+(相鄰選擇器) h1+p,選擇緊接在另一個元素后的元素,而且二者有相同的父元素。只會選擇第一個相鄰的匹配元素 ...
總結來源於官方文檔:https://www.crummy.com/software/BeautifulSoup/bs4/doc/index.zh.html#find-all 示例代碼段 1、快速操作: 2、Beautiful Soup ...
前面的話 CSS的一個核心特性是能向文檔中的一組元素類型應用某些規則,本文將詳細介紹CSS選擇器 [注意]關於選擇器兼容性的詳細信息移步至此 通配選擇器 星號*代表通配選擇器,可以與任何元素匹配 元素選擇器 文檔的元素是最基本的選擇器 ...